Community Commission on Police Oversight
Remote
The city clerk informed the commission that they don’t have the ability to create subcommittees, which the commission previously voted to create. Instead, he said, the commission has to request this ability from the City Council and mayor, or the commission can use working groups, which are not subject to Open Meeting Law. Several commissioners said they saw this as the city creating a barrier to their progress.
Commissioner Gurian Sherman made a motion to voluntarily make the commission’s working groups comply with Open Meeting Law. This motion failed after a 5-5 vote. Several commissioners voiced support for making working groups fully accessible to public in the spirit of transparency Several commissioners expressed concern with public involvement hampering productivity and over burdening commissioners’ time
Nine members of the public gave public comment. Most shared various frustrations with the commission’s progress and dismay with the city’s involvement.
